<p class="MsoNormal"><b class=""><span style="font-size:9.0pt;font-family:"Tahoma",sans-serif" class="">ABOUT THE FOREST:</span></b></p>
<p class=""><span style="font-size:9.0pt;font-family:"Tahoma",sans-serif" class="">San Bernardino Community</span></p>
<p class=""><span style="font-size:9.0pt;font-family:"Tahoma",sans-serif" class="">The San Bernardino National Forest, one of 18 National Forests in the State, is located in the counties of San Bernardino and Riverside. The Forest covers approximately 670,000
acres and lies above the surrounding cities of Ontario, Rancho Cucamonga, Fontana, Rialto, San Bernardino, Redlands, Mentone, Yucaipa, Banning, Beaumont, Apple Valley, Victorville, Lucerne Valley and the resort communities around Palm Springs. Several mountaintop
communities, including Idyllwild, Lake Arrowhead, Wrightwood, and Big Bear are surrounded entirely by the National Forest. The Forest encompasses all or portions of several high elevation mountain ranges, including the eastern portions of the San Gabriel Mountains,
the San Bernardino Mountains, and the Santa Rosa and San Jacinto Mountains. Major interstates cross the Forest, including I-10 and I-15.</span></p>
<p class=""><span style="font-size:9.0pt;font-family:"Tahoma",sans-serif" class="">The Forest and surrounding areas offer a wide variety of recreational opportunities for hunting, hiking, backpacking, fishing, sightseeing, off-highway vehicles, mountain biking,
winter recreation, and horseback riding. Significant visitor attractions include the Big Bear Discovery Center, National Children’s Forest, and the Santa Rosa and San Jacinto Mountains National Monument. The Forest is one of the four forests in southern California
that are part of the National Forest Adventure Pass Program (a Recreation Fee Demonstration Project). The Forest has numerous recreation and non-recreation special uses, including significant transportation and utility corridors that feed the Inland Empire
and LA Basin. The many urban communities along the foothills of the San Bernardino and San Gabriel Mountains together with the mountain communities surrounded by the National Forest add complexity to the management environment of the wildland urban interface.</span></p>
